Design Details
NECKLINES
Jewel Neck
Round neckline that makes a good background for jewelry and necklaces
Crew
A high round neckline finished with a knit band
Cowl
A neckline cut on the bias to make the neckline drape better
Boat
Boat neckline
Sweetheart neck
Moderately low and heart shaped in front
Scoop neckline
A deep U-shape neckline A full curve that dips down the chest
Pants
Flared pants
Pants are in the shape of a bell at the bottom
Straight leg pant
Pants are the same width from the thigh to the ankle
Taperedskinny
Pant width narrows as it goes down to the ankle
Collars
Shirt Collar
Collar is pointed and unattached
Button Down Collar
Collar is attached with buttons
Notched Collar
A collar with v-shaped cut-outs
Peter Pan collar
a flat collar with rounded ends that meet at the front
Mandarin Collar
a small close-fitting upright collar
Sleeves
Set in Sleeve
Joined to the garment by an arm hold seam (seam starting at the edge of the shoulder and continuing around the armhole)
Raglan Sleeve
Has a front and back diagonal seam that extends from the neck to the armhole
Leg O Mutton Sleeve
Resembling a leg of mutton in shape tapering sharply from one large end to a point or smaller end
Dolman Sleeve
A full sleeve that is very wide at the armhole and narrow at the wrist
Shirt Cuff Sleeve
wide cuff for a shirt sleeve that is folded back and fastened with a cuff link
French Cuff Sleeve
a shirt cuff that is folded back before fastening creating a double-layered cuff
Jackets and Coats
Blazer
A jacket that can be single or double breasted
Bolero Jacket
A shrug is a cropped cardigan-like garment with short or long sleeves
Double Breasted Jacket
having a substantial overlap of material at the front and showing two rows of buttons when fastened
Tuxedo Jacket
a formal evening suit distinguished primarily by satin or on the jacket lapels
Chanel Jacket
A jacket with no collar or cuff can be used for day or night wear
Trench Coat
a loose belted double-breasted raincoat in a military style
Pea Coat
a short double-breasted overcoat of coarse woolen cloth formerly worn by sailors
Skirts
Straight Skirt
Fitted skirt with no gathers or extra fabric
Gored
Pieces of fabric sewn together so the skirt flares out
Wrap
Fabric that wraps around the body and ties or fastens
A-Line Skirt
a skirt that is fitted at the hips and gradually widens towards the hem
Yoke Skirt
Form fitted piece of fabric at the top of the skirt with a looser part attached to it
Gathered Skirt
a skirt whose fabric is drawn together around the waist
Shirts
T-Shirt
a short-sleeved casual top generally made of cotton having the shape of a T when spread out flat
Henley
a casual top with a scoop neck and a short row of buttons in the center of the neckline
Polo
a casual short-sleeved cotton shirt with a collar and several buttons at the neck
Dress Shirt
a mans white shirt worn with a bow tie and a dinner jacket on formal occasions
Fitted Shirt
A shirt that may be custom made to fit closer to the body
Tuxedo Shirt
a mans shirt usually white worn as part of formal evening dress usually having a stiffened or decorative front
DRESSES
Sheath Dress
A close-fitting dress that is shaped by darts
Shift Dress
A loose-fitting dress
Tubular
Princess Dress
A close fitting flared dress that is shaped by seams
Empire
the dress has a fitted bodice ending just below the bust
Drop Waist
The waistline is found below the natural waistline just above the hips
Shirt Waist
A womans dress that resembles a shirt
